George Lewis Heaton Sr., 97

| September 7, 2013 4:00 PM

George Lewis Heaton Sr., 97, passed away on Aug. 6, 2013, at the Montana Veterans Home in Columbia Falls.

George was a two-time honorable World War II veteran in the U.S. Air Force.

He retired from Rome Cable/Alco Aluminum, then built and ran his own hardware store in Camino, Calif.

George Sr. was an honest man who believed in his country. He was a loving man who touched many people’s lives. He was liked by all.

He outlived his parents, siblings and children. He was a true survivor who never gave up, but always gave. He was a gentleman who would, and did, give the shirt off his back with no expectation of thanks.

“I can’t say enough about the man, but those who knew him ... knew.”

He is survived by his great-granddaughters, Stormy J. Heaton and Cassi K. Heaton, and grandson, Mateo Heaton.

“Rest in peace, Grandpa. We will always love, miss and remember you. Love, Tater and girls.”
